A condiment station is a self-service counter that gathers sauces, drinks, and plate storage in one place so guests dress their own dishes and staff stop shuttling between tables and the kitchen. This one is built for hot pot restaurants, BBQ houses, and food-court buffets, where a steady stream of diners needs bottles, dipping-sauce slots, and clean plates within arm's reach. The three-tier layout puts bottles and water on top, 10+ sauce slots across the middle, and a wide open lower bay for bulk drinks or stacked plates — so a single unit runs as a restocking hub rather than three separate carts.

The frame is 1.5 mm reinforced wrought iron finished with a high-temperature electrostatic powder coating that resists acid, alkali, and heavy oil — the everyday reality of a hot pot line. Because it ships as one all-welded structure rather than a knock-down cabinet, it stays rigid under heavy inventory and doesn't develop the wobble that flat-pack counters do in a busy service.
